我正在尝试从源代码交叉编译Qt4.7.1,这里有一些关于我的设置的注释:我的预期输出是运行Qt应用程序所需的共享对象库。我的目标平台是采用ARMCortex-A8架构的TIAM335x处理器。我的开发平台是x8664位Ubuntu虚拟机我对这应该如何工作的理解是我下载了我的目标平台的工具链(这是TI的Linaro工具链),我下载了Qt4.7.1的源代码。,我将mkspec设置为使用我的工具链,运行configure,然后只需要运行make/makeinstall我应该能够找到我告诉它安装到的所有.so。然而,我在实现这个想法时遇到了很多问题。首先,我下载了TISDK版本:ti-sdk-
我正在尝试从源代码交叉编译Qt4.7.1,这里有一些关于我的设置的注释:我的预期输出是运行Qt应用程序所需的共享对象库。我的目标平台是采用ARMCortex-A8架构的TIAM335x处理器。我的开发平台是x8664位Ubuntu虚拟机我对这应该如何工作的理解是我下载了我的目标平台的工具链(这是TI的Linaro工具链),我下载了Qt4.7.1的源代码。,我将mkspec设置为使用我的工具链,运行configure,然后只需要运行make/makeinstall我应该能够找到我告诉它安装到的所有.so。然而,我在实现这个想法时遇到了很多问题。首先,我下载了TISDK版本:ti-sdk-
什么是QTQT是一个跨平台的C++图像用户界面应用程序框架QT在1991年由奇趣科技开发QT的优点跨平台,几乎支持所有平台接口简单,容易上手一定程度上简化了内存回收机制有很好的社区氛围可以进行嵌入式开发QWidgetQT注意事项命名规范类名首字母大写,单词和单词之间首字母大写函数名变量名称首字母小写,单词和单词之间首字母大写快捷键注释ctrl+/运行ctrl+r编译ctrl+b查找ctrl+f帮助文档F1自动对齐ctrl+i同名的.h和.cpp切换F4按钮按钮常用APIshow()以顶层方式弹出窗口控件setParent()选择依赖方式setText()设置文本resize()重置窗口大小mo
我正尝试在某个TI板上启动我的交叉编译的GUIQt应用程序。我使用此命令启动应用程序:QT_DEBUG_PLUGINS=1QT_PLUGIN_PATH=/root/qt-5.2.1-install/pluginsLD_LIBRARY_PATH=/root/qt-5.2.1-install/lib/./simple_qml_ui-platformlinuxfb不幸的是,错误发生了:QFactoryLoader::QFactoryLoader()checkingdirectorypath"/root/qt_app/styles"...QFactoryLoader::QFactoryLoad
我正尝试在某个TI板上启动我的交叉编译的GUIQt应用程序。我使用此命令启动应用程序:QT_DEBUG_PLUGINS=1QT_PLUGIN_PATH=/root/qt-5.2.1-install/pluginsLD_LIBRARY_PATH=/root/qt-5.2.1-install/lib/./simple_qml_ui-platformlinuxfb不幸的是,错误发生了:QFactoryLoader::QFactoryLoader()checkingdirectorypath"/root/qt_app/styles"...QFactoryLoader::QFactoryLoad
ListWidget列表框组件,该组件与TreeWidget有些相似,区别在于TreeWidget可以实现嵌套以及多字段结构,而ListWidget组件则只能实现单字段结构,ListWidget组件常用于显示单条记录,例如只显示IP地址,用户名等数据,如下笔记是本人在开发中经常用到的一些基本操作技巧,包括列表框组件的基本操作方法。常用节点间的操作方法如下:ListView组件与应用基础ListWidget初始化ListWidget变化行(触发事件)ListWidget编辑状态设置ListWidget全选/全不选ListWidget反选(对错交织)ListWidget指定位置插入/增加一项Lis
我使用Qt-Creator2.5.2SDK在Linux上开发C代码。从SDK界面(例如,ctrl+R)运行代码时,如何以root身份运行代码? 最佳答案 以root身份运行Qt-Creator的最简单解决方案老实说,这不是一项微不足道的任务(只要我之前尝试过自己做)。你确定你真的需要在root下运行调试吗?如果是关于访问某些设备节点,可能更容易调整对它们的权限?另一种解决方案(让QTcreator在用户帐户下运行可以是这样的)调整sudoers(/etc/sudoers)=NOPASSWD:/usr/bin/gdb然后制作一个类似/
我使用Qt-Creator2.5.2SDK在Linux上开发C代码。从SDK界面(例如,ctrl+R)运行代码时,如何以root身份运行代码? 最佳答案 以root身份运行Qt-Creator的最简单解决方案老实说,这不是一项微不足道的任务(只要我之前尝试过自己做)。你确定你真的需要在root下运行调试吗?如果是关于访问某些设备节点,可能更容易调整对它们的权限?另一种解决方案(让QTcreator在用户帐户下运行可以是这样的)调整sudoers(/etc/sudoers)=NOPASSWD:/usr/bin/gdb然后制作一个类似/
在使用克隆的github项目运行qmake时出现上述标题错误。以下是项目文件。#-------------------------------------------------##ProjectcreatedbyQtCreator2013-01-18T22:28:41##-------------------------------------------------QT+=coreguiwidgetswebkitwidgetssqlgui-privatexmlTARGET=zealtarget.path=/usr/binINSTALLS=targetTEMPLATE=appSOUR
在使用克隆的github项目运行qmake时出现上述标题错误。以下是项目文件。#-------------------------------------------------##ProjectcreatedbyQtCreator2013-01-18T22:28:41##-------------------------------------------------QT+=coreguiwidgetswebkitwidgetssqlgui-privatexmlTARGET=zealtarget.path=/usr/binINSTALLS=targetTEMPLATE=appSOUR